package org.apache.sling.scripting.freemarker.wrapper;
import freemarker.template.TemplateModel;
import freemarker.template.TemplateSequenceModel;
import freemarker.template.TemplateModelException;
import freemarker.template.SimpleScalar;
import javax.jcr.Property;
import javax.jcr.Value;
import javax.jcr.RepositoryException;
/**
* A wrapper for JCR multi value properties to support freemarker scripting.
*/
public class PropertyListModel implements TemplateSequenceModel {
private Value[] values;
public PropertyListModel(Property property) throws RepositoryException {
this.values = property.getValues();
}
/**
* Retrieves the i-th template model in this sequence.
*
* @return the item at the specified index, or <code>null</code> if
* the index is out of bounds. Note that a <code>null</code> value is
* interpreted by FreeMarker as "variable does not exist", and accessing
* a missing variables is usually considered as an error in the FreeMarker
* Template Language, so the usage of a bad index will not remain hidden.
*/
public TemplateModel get(int index) throws TemplateModelException {
try {
return new SimpleScalar(values[index].getString());
} catch (RepositoryException e) {
throw new TemplateModelException(e);
}
}
/**
* @return the number of items in the list.
*/
public int size() throws TemplateModelException {
return values.length;
}
}
